6/3/12 CSI: NY

This week I watched the crime drama csi new york, created by the same people of csi: miami. Mac Taylor is the main co-protagonist played by Gary Sinise, alongside Stella Bonasera & Jo Danville. Csi is a rather fast paced show because the crime committed occurs right at the beginning of the show and the rest of the show consists of the professionals trying to find out what and who killed the victim. There is always a recurrence of multiple suspects in csi to keep the audiences suspense in action and builds the tension up when there is a lot of clues and evidence found. There are many flashbacks where it re-constructs the murder of the victim and sometimes shows why some evidence was left and how it got there. Csi is more glamorous and stylish in comparison to fellow crime dramas like Sherlock and Luther and the setting of csi being in the city differs from the gritty, rural areas that consist in Sherlock. The professionals in Csi NY are the police, investigators, detectives, medics, lawyers, the press & judges. Many montages of murders occur during the show too. It is technology over everything, even human interaction in csi so there is only a slight chance of sight to see practical work done by the actual detectives rather than the technology taking the role of the detectives.
